On September 20-22, 2023, Davis Polk partners Ning Chiu and Kyoko Takahashi Lin will be among the speakers at the 2023 Proxy Disclosure & 20th Annual Executive Compensation Conferences, presented by TheCorporateCounsel.net and CompensationStandards.com.

At the Proxy Disclosure Conference, Ning will speak on two panels. “Director Skills & Backgrounds: Why Your Disclosures Need a Refresh… & How To Do It” will discuss the steps all companies should be taking to effectively understand and communicate the value each director brings to the board to avoid activist threats, and “Political Spending: Practical Governance & Disclosure Steps for Fraught Times” will cover practical takeaways for this new era of tighter board oversight, including what companies of all sizes need to do on policies, governance, controls &and disclosures. Ning will also speak on the “Navigating ISS & Glass Lewis” panel at the Executive Compensation Conference. Panelists will discuss preparing for issues that could affect 2024 support for say-on-pay and equity plan resolutions – as well as compensation committee elections – including key policy changes, disclosure do’s and don’ts, and tips for engaging with proxy advisors.

Kyoko will speak on two panels at the Executive Compensation Conference. “Clawbacks: Key Action Items Now” will address the most common approach to the new Dodd-Frank clawback rule, what processes you need for your new policy, the current enforcement environment and landmines to avoid as you proceed with implementation and disclosure. “ESG Metrics: Beyond the Basics” will discuss strategies and steps for overcoming ESG complexities.
